In this video I take on our 1984 Porsche 944 that was painted in a carport with heavy machinery paint. A match made in heaven? I would have to agree. This paint came with some absolutely insane texture so I decided to wet sand it in hopes to level it out a little bit and achieve better clarity. I started with 2000 grit hard block, followed by 3000 grit soft block. The paintwork was then cut and polished, I didn't remove as much texture as I would have liked but with further knowledge of the paint I can now say a bunch of the texture was retained in the base-coat. Over all the car went through a massive transformation and I'm happy with how it looks! Next ill tackle the interior and wheels. I hope you guys enjoy!

An alternative to wet sanding that is very effective, and much safer for a single stage paint is to use Comet cleaner. Wet the surface, spread the comet liberally and use a terrycloth or sponge. The abrasive action will pull away oxidization and light surface swirling. Then, use maguires #7. Liberally coat the surface and leave overnight and then rub off. Do this a couple of times. Just another approach for folks who don't want to risk wet sanding.
